A Plan to Financial Security: A Phased- Guide
Embarking on your journey towards economic freedom can seem daunting, but with a well-defined roadmap, it's entirely achievable. First, determine your current financial situation – track income and expenses diligently to understand where your money is going. Next, develop a realistic budget that prioritizes setting aside capital. Then, start eliminating high-interest debt like credit cards; this frees up cash flow for further investment. Simultaneously, build an emergency fund—aiming for 3-6 months of living expenses offers a crucial safety net. Afterward, consider placing funds in diversified assets such as stocks, bonds, and real estate, taking into account your risk tolerance and long-term goals. This methodology involves aggressively saving a significant portion of your income – often 50% or more - to build up a substantial nest egg, allowing you to retire much earlier than the conventional retirement age. However, achieving FIRE requires immense dedication, meticulous financial planning, and a willingness to live frugally. It’s not simply about having lots of money; it's about strategically minimizing your expenses and maximizing your investments to reach a point where your assets generate enough income to cover your living costs. This involves more than just saving money; it's about optimizing your investments. Consider a diversified portfolio that blends low-cost index ETFs with carefully selected individual shares, potentially including real estate or other alternative assets. Consistently rebalancing is vital to maintaining your desired asset allocation, and remember to factor in tax-advantaged accounts like 401(k)s or IRAs for maximum benefit. Don’t overlook the power of dividend reinvestment – letting those earnings work for you can significantly accelerate your progress toward financial independence.
